Kia Optima: Front Door / Front Door Module
Components and components location
Repair procedures
• |
When removing with a flat-tip screwdriver or remover, wrap protective
tape around the tools to prevent damage to components.
|
• |
Put on gloves to prevent hand injuries.
|
|
1. |
Remove the front door window glass.
(Refer to Front Door - "Front Door Window Glass")
|
2. |
Using a screwdriver or remover, remove the outside rear view mirror cover
(A).
|
3. |
Separate the outside mirror connector (A) and remove the mounting clip.
|
4. |
Release the locking pin in the direction of the arrow and remove the
front door main wiring connector (A).
|
5. |
Loosen the mounting bolts and remove the front door module (A).
Tightening torque :
7.8 - 11.8 N·m (0.8 - 1.2 kgf·m, 5.8 - 8.7 lb·ft)
|
|
6. |
Disconnect the front door latch connectors (A).
|
7. |
Disconnect the connectors and front door module wiring harness.
|
8. |
Remove the front speaker.
(Refer to Body Electrical System - "Speakers")
|
9. |
Remove the front power window motor.
(Refer to Body Electrical System - "Power Window Motor")
|
10. |
To install, reverse the removal procedure.
•
|
Make sure connectors are connected properly and each
rod is connected securely.
|
•
|
Make sure the door locks / unlocks and opens / closes
properly.
|
